RadioShack
Telecommunications · Software development · Solar and photovoltaics · Security technology
1480 NE Burnside Rd, 97030 GreshamTelecommunications · Software development · Solar and photovoltaics · Security technology
1480 NE Burnside Rd, 97030 GreshamTelecommunications · Software development · Solar and photovoltaics · Security technology
1547 NE 40th Ave, 97232 PortlandHealth insurance · Hospital pharmacy · Software development
2120 SW Jefferson St, 97201 PortlandSoftware development
P.O. Box 2435, 97208 PortlandTelecommunications · Software development · Solar and photovoltaics · Security technology
1606 NE 6th Ave, 97232 PortlandInternet provider · Computer center · Software development
2310 NW Everett Suite 200, 97210 PortlandSoftware development
14795 SW Murray Scholls Drive Suite 201, 97007 BeavertonSoftware development
14795 SW Murray Scholls Dr. Suite 201, 97007 Beavertondesign · Web design · Software development
930 NW 14th Ave, 97209 PortlandFinancial service provider · transportation · Print shop · Software development · Warehouse logistics
1035 NW 14th Ave, 97209 PortlandWeb design · Software development
1740 NW Marshall St, 97209 PortlandReal estate agent · Construction company · House building · Software development
3637 NE 122nd Ave, 97230 PortlandSoftware development
4560 SW 110Th Ave., 97005 BeavertonPC repair · Software development
6075 SW 124Th Ave. , 97008 BeavertonSoftware development
4900 Sw Griffith Dr, 97005 BeavertonSoftware development
2820 Northup Way Suite 140, 98004 PortlandSoftware development
4240 SW 109th Ave, 97005 BeavertonSoftware development · consulting · design · Engineering office
4035 Ne Shaver St, 97212 PortlandSoftware development
PO Box 6656, 97007 Beaverton